Leaving Pittsburgh on way to Chicago, we found this place on Google maps this morning. They have almost 5 stars. Figured this place has to be really good. So we picked this place because of the stars and because our family always supports small businesses. So glad we stopped by to eat here.
Got there just around 8am not too crowded, was able to get a seat within the first 3 mins. Sat down, took a good 7 mins before ordered. That’s when they start getting busy. Understandable. The food was perfect. I ordered the “Hungry Jack Breakfast” and got my son the kids meal “Junior Waffle-O - 1/2 waffle, 1 egg, 2 strips of bacon or 2 links”. These were just the right size portion. Most people like big meals, and some might say the adult meal is small. I would disagree, it was perfect and the right size portion. The price was fair and the good taste was great. The bacon was perfectly crisp! That’s the hard one to get right. These guys did! I would give 5 stars for service but I felt as if the staff could be a little more energetic and happy. Seems like their tired or something’s bothering them. I would highly recommend name tags so it’s easier to give praise to a specific staff member.
Parking has limited spaces, so you may have to park further down the parking lot away from the front doors if you arrive when it’s busy.

Read moreWe have been wanting to visit this restaurant for a while. We arrived at 10 am and there was not a wait. We were seated promptly. We did observe that people that arrived after us had about a 5 minute wait. Our server was nice and moved around the room helping people. The restaurant is decent-sized and the tables are spread out. We were seated at a booth.
Our waitress provided drinks and came back quickly to get our orders. The menu was extensive but not too busy looking. I ordered The C’s Special which included two eggs, hash browns and toast. My eggs and hash browns came out perfect, just like I ordered them. My son’s waffles were big and made perfectly. They were fluffy, a little crispy and delicious!
